Must-Have Book #1: ‘The Dance Music Manual’ – Your DJ Bible
If you’re going to invest in a single book about EDM production, make it ‘The Dance Music Manual’ by Rick Snoman. This book is like a treasure chest of knowledge, packed with industry insights, tips, and techniques. It dives deep into the nuts and bolts of dance music production, covering everything from composition to mastering. If you’re serious about making music, this one’s your go-to guide!
Must-Have Book #2: ‘Making Electronic Music’ – The Roadmap You Need
Looking for a step-by-step guide that demystifies electronic music creation? ‘Making Electronic Music’ by Dennis DeSantis is what you need! This book breaks down complex concepts into bite-sized pieces, making it easier for producers of all levels. It’s more than just a manual; it’s a roadmap that teaches you to articulate your musical ideas and understand the production process from the ground up.
Must-Have Book #3: ‘This Is Your Brain On Music’ – Science + Sound = Magic
Ever wondered what happens inside your noggin when you hear that bass drop? ‘This Is Your Brain On Music’ by Daniel Levitin explores the intersection of neuroscience and the art of music creation. You’ll uncover the psychological effects of sound, rhythm, and harmony, which can profoundly influence your music-making process. Understanding the science behind sound can unlock your creative potential in ways you never thought possible!

Must-Have Book #5: ‘Mixing Secrets for the Small Studio’ – Because Mixing Doesn’t Have to Be Rocket Science
Many producers sweat bullets over mixing, thinking it’s an insurmountable task. Enter ‘Mixing Secrets for the Small Studio’ by Mike Senior. This book demystifies the mixing process, offering practical tips and techniques that can be applied in a small home studio. It emphasizes that with the right knowledge and approach, anyone can create polished, professional-sounding tracks. You’ve got this!
